Why Live in Harvard

Harvard, Massachusetts, is a small town in Worcester County known for its historical significance and community-oriented atmosphere. The town boasts a highly-rated school district with Hildreth Elementary and The Bromfield School, both of which are recognized for their academic excellence. Harvard's housing market features colonial-style homes on large lots with mature trees, offering spacious living with an average home size of 3,300 square feet. Residents enjoy a variety of things to do, including outdoor activities at Bare Hill Pond, which is popular for swimming, ice fishing, and cross-country skiing. Harvard Park provides additional recreational options with its playground, running track, and trails. The town's charming character is evident in its local amenities, such as the Harvard General Store, which offers homemade baked goods and specialty pizzas, and the seasonal produce available at Westward Orchards and Carlson Orchards. Historical sites like the Fruitlands Museum and the annual Harvard Flea Market add to the town's appeal. Despite its small size, Harvard is conveniently located 45 miles west of Boston and 25 miles northeast of Worcester, making it accessible to larger cities for major services. The town has a very low crime risk compared to the national average, contributing to its desirability as a place to live.
